Description
A fabulous find on the 7th floor of a secure modern block, the sun-lit living room has glorious views looking east over beaches and the sea to Brighton’s famous Marina. The streamlined kitchen has a designer finish, the bedroom is quiet and comfortable with fitted wardrobes to fill and the shower room is a stylish sanctuary. With the fashionable, al fresco lifestyle of Kemptown Village which hosts both Pride and the County Hospital around the corner, now is the time to buy with substantial improvements taking place along the seafront’s famous Victorian arched walkways.
With a discreet, secure entrance from a side road and lifts to take you to the astonishing views of the 7th floor, inside, the sun-lit living room has both a large window and giant bay in the east wall so you can enjoy the holiday vista over Kemptown, its beaches and open water even when seated. With 5.62 x 5.13m (18’5 x 16’9) there’s ample space to entertain with a fireplace to ensure a warm welcome, and custom made shelving and cabinets are already built in. Next door, the streamlined kitchen is good to go where high spec appliances include a touch induction hob beneath a hood, a fan oven at eye level and a microwave, and this space becomes sociable simply by leaving the door open.
Facing east for the sunrise over the coastal cliffs and Brighton Marina, the restful bedroom is private with fabulous views over So-Ho house and along beaches with café bars and a lido to a glittering cityscape, and this spacious double room of 4 x 3.53m (13’1 x 11’6) has almost a whole wall of wardrobes to fill.
Across the hallway, so also convenient for guests, the contemporary bathroom is a stylish refuge with a high end finish and electric shower so water pressure shouldn’t be an issue

Location Summary:
Kemptown is a great place to be with a vibrant mix of cafés, shops, bars, restaurants and essentials like supermarkets and pharmacies - and it is bordered by the sea. Local beaches have amenities including a zip wire, sauna spa, lido, gym and café/bars. Within an easy walk of the international shopping, restaurants, cinemas and theatres of the historic heart of the city it is convenient for the County, General and Nuffield Hospitals, Amex, the law courts and universities as well as parks and gardens which provide open spaces, sports facilities and host arts events in city festivals. The whole of Brighton and Hove including Brighton Station is easy to reach on foot, by bus or by car, and if you need a car permit zone C has no waiting list.
